Comprehending Small Exotic Birds
Small unique birds encompass a range of species, consisting of parakeets, canaries, finches, and lovebirds. Each species has its own unique characteristics, care requirements, and potential lifespan. To highlight this, here is a valuable table summarizing crucial attributes of popular small exotic birds:

While little unique birds can be delightful family pets, possible owners ought to think about numerous factors before purchasing:
Time Commitment: Birds require daily interaction, psychological stimulation, and routine cleansing of their cages.Social Needs: Some bird types flourish on social interactions, either with human beings or other birds. Think about if you can offer the required friendship.Dietary Requirements: Different species have distinct dietary needs that must be met for their health.Veterinary Care: Birds require access to bird veterinarians. Ensure that such services are offered in your location.Long Lifespan: Certain species can live 10-20 years, so consider if you can dedicate to taking care of a pet for that long.Where to Buy Small Exotic Birds
Discovering a trusted source is important for guaranteeing your new feathered good friend is healthy and well-cared-for. Below are some options:

As soon as you've selected the types and purchased your new buddy, it's vital to supply appropriate care. Here are some essential parts of bird care:
Diet: A well balanced diet plan is important. The majority of little exotic birds prosper on a mixture of seeds, pellets, fruits, and veggies.Cage Setup: Ensure a roomy cage with appropriate setting down, toys, and hiding areas to keep your bird promoted and pleased.Routine Interaction: Spend time every day communicating with your bird to construct trust and confidence.Health Monitoring: Keep an eye out for indications of illness, such as modifications in habits, consuming habits, or Pflege Von Graupapageien feather quality. Routine veterinary check-ups are advised.Socializing: Consider getting a pair of birds of the same types if you're not able to commit enough time to a single bird.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
